2. Fundamentals of Landing Page SEO

2.1 Distinguishing Characteristics from General Website SEO

Search Engine Optimization for landing pages, while sharing foundational principles with general website SEO, exhibits several key differences stemming from the distinct objectives and structures of each. One of the primary distinctions lies in the narrower keyword targeting employed for landing pages. Unlike websites that aim to rank for a broad spectrum of keywords related to the business, products, or services, landing pages typically focus on a specific set of keywords that are highly transactional and represent users at the bottom of the marketing funnel.5 This targeted approach ensures that the traffic driven to the page is more qualified and closer to conversion.

Another critical difference is the emphasis on a singular conversion goal.1 Websites often have multiple objectives, such as providing information, engaging visitors, and facilitating various types of conversions. In contrast, a landing page is designed with one primary goal in mind, whether it's lead generation, a direct sale, or a sign-up for a specific offer. This focused objective dictates the content, design, and SEO strategy of the landing page. Consequently, landing page content is often shorter and more concise, directly supporting the call-to-action related to the specific campaign or offer, unlike the rich and varied content found across multiple pages of a website.6

Navigation also differs significantly. Websites typically feature comprehensive navigation menus allowing users to explore various sections and learn more about the business. Landing pages, however, often have limited or no website navigation to keep visitors focused on the conversion goal and prevent distractions that might lead them away from the intended action.2 Finally, the SEO efforts for landing pages are frequently tied to the duration of a specific marketing campaign.8 While website SEO is generally a long-term strategy aimed at building a strong online presence over time, landing page SEO might be more short-lived, aligned with the lifecycle of a particular promotional effort. The fundamental intent behind the optimization differs as well. Website SEO seeks to build overall domain authority and attract traffic for diverse purposes, whereas landing page SEO is primarily driven by the immediate need to convert visitors for a specific campaign. This difference in objective shapes the selection of keywords, the structure of content, and the overall design of the page.

2.2 Core Google Ranking Factors Relevant to Landing Pages

While a multitude of factors influence Google's search rankings, several core elements are particularly relevant to the SEO performance of landing pages. Keyword relevance remains a cornerstone, requiring the strategic use of relevant keywords and phrases that the target audience is likely to search for.3 These keywords should be incorporated naturally into various on-page elements. High-quality, original, and relevant content is equally crucial. The content must meet the user's search intent, providing valuable information or a compelling offer that aligns with their needs.3 Google prioritizes websites with fast page load speeds, as slow loading times can negatively impact user experience and increase bounce rates.3 Therefore, optimizing loading times is essential for landing pages.

Given the prevalence of mobile browsing, mobile-friendliness and responsive design are significant ranking factors.3 Landing pages must be accessible and user-friendly across various devices and screen sizes. User experience (UX) and engagement metrics, such as bounce rate, dwell time, and click-through rate (CTR), also play a vital role. Google considers how users interact with a page as an indicator of its quality and relevance.3 While domain authority and a strong backlink profile are generally more influential for overall website SEO, high-quality backlinks to a landing page can still enhance its credibility and ranking potential.3 Finally, various technical SEO aspects, including the implementation of schema markup, a clear URL structure, the use of HTTPS for security, and ensuring proper crawlability and indexability by search engines, are all relevant to the ranking of landing pages.3 While many of these factors apply to both websites and landing pages, the emphasis on elements like page speed and mobile-friendliness is often heightened for landing pages due to their direct impact on conversion rates.

3. Strategic Keyword Research for Landing Pages

3.1 Identifying High-Intent, Conversion-Focused Keywords

The foundation of successful landing page SEO lies in the strategic identification of keywords that not only attract relevant traffic but also demonstrate a high likelihood of conversion. This involves focusing on high-intent keywords, which are terms that indicate a searcher's readiness to take a specific action.5 These keywords often have a transactional or commercial intent, suggesting that the user is looking to make a purchase, sign up for a service, download a resource, or complete some other form of conversion.

Marketers should prioritize bottom-of-funnel keywords, which target users who are further along in the buying cycle and are actively seeking a solution or are very close to making a decision.5 Examples of such keywords include specific product names (e.g., "buy iPhone 16"), service-related terms with modifiers indicating intent (e.g., "schedule a free consultation for SEO services"), or phrases that include action-oriented words (e.g., "download free ebook on content marketing"). By focusing on these types of keywords, businesses can ensure that their landing pages attract visitors who are not just browsing but are actively looking to engage with their offerings, thereby maximizing the potential for conversions from organic search traffic.

3.2 Understanding and Targeting User Intent (Informational, Navigational, Transactional, Commercial)

A crucial aspect of effective keyword research for landing pages is a deep understanding of user intent, which refers to the underlying reason why someone performs a search query.3 Search intent is typically categorized into four main types: informational, navigational, transactional, and commercial.

Landing pages should be carefully aligned with the specific intent behind the search queries they target. For informational intent, where users are seeking to learn about a topic or find answers to specific questions, landing pages might provide simple, useful answers, helpful tips, or in-depth guides.5 For commercial intent, where users are researching options before making a purchase decision, landing pages can highlight comparisons between products or services, emphasize unique benefits, and showcase key features.5 Finally, for transactional intent, where users are ready to take an action like buying a product or signing up for a service, landing pages should be optimized with clear and prominent calls-to-action and a straightforward pathway to conversion.5 By tailoring the landing page content and design to match the user's intent, businesses can create a more relevant and satisfying experience, leading to higher engagement, lower bounce rates, and ultimately improved conversion rates.

3.3 Leveraging Long-Tail Keywords for Niche Targeting and Higher Conversion Rates

Long-tail keywords, which are longer and more specific keyword phrases typically consisting of three or more words, offer a valuable opportunity for landing pages to achieve niche targeting and potentially higher conversion rates.5 These keywords are often less competitive than shorter, more generic terms, making it easier for landing pages to rank higher in search engine results for these specific queries.

Long-tail keywords often reflect more specific user needs and indicate that the searcher is further along in the buying cycle.32 For example, instead of a broad keyword like "running shoes," a long-tail keyword might be "best trail running shoes for women with flat feet." Users searching with such specific phrases have a clearer idea of what they are looking for, and a landing page that directly addresses their needs is more likely to result in a conversion. Examples of long-tail keywords relevant to landing pages could include specific product names combined with attributes (e.g., "affordable co-friendly yoga mats for beginners" 7), detailed service descriptions with location qualifiers (e.g., "organic dog food delivery service in Dallas" 7), or question-based queries (e.g., "how to fix a leaky faucet in under 30 minutes"). By targeting these highly specific long-tail keywords, businesses can attract a more qualified audience to their landing pages, increasing their chances of converting visitors into customers.

3.4 Utilizing Keyword Research Tools Effectively

To effectively identify high-intent and long-tail keywords for landing pages, marketers should leverage a variety of keyword research tools.3 Popular options include Google Keyword Planner, Semrush, Ahrefs, Moz Keyword Explorer, and Ubersuggest. These tools provide valuable data on keyword search volume, competition levels, and related keyword ideas.

When using these tools for landing page SEO, it's crucial to utilize intent-based filters to prioritize keywords with transactional and commercial intent.5 Marketers should also analyze competitor keyword strategies to identify potential opportunities and understand which keywords their competitors are ranking for.5 The goal is to find keywords that have high search volume, indicating a significant number of people are searching for them, but also have low to medium competition, making it more feasible for a landing page to rank well, especially for newer pages.7 Additionally, focusing on keywords with clear commercial intent can help attract visitors who are more likely to convert into sales or sign-ups.7 By effectively using these tools and filters, marketers can identify the most valuable keywords to target with their landing pages, driving high-quality traffic and improving conversion rates.

4. On-Page Optimization Techniques for Landing Pages

4.1 Optimizing Title Tags and Meta Descriptions for Click-Through Rate and Relevance

The title tag and meta description are crucial on-page elements that significantly influence how a landing page appears in Google's search results and can impact its click-through rate (CTR). The title tag, which appears as the clickable headline in the SERPs and in the browser tab, should ideally include the primary keyword, placed as close to the beginning as possible, and be concise, typically within 50-60 characters.3 The meta description, a short summary of the page's content displayed below the title tag in search results, should be compelling and informative, enticing users to click. It should also include the target keyword and a clear call-to-action, while remaining within the recommended length of under 160 characters.3

It is essential that each landing page has a unique title tag and meta description that accurately reflects the specific content of that page and aligns with the user's search intent.52 By crafting relevant and engaging meta tags, marketers can improve the visibility of their landing pages in search results and encourage more users to click through to their site, ultimately driving targeted traffic and increasing the potential for conversions.

4.2 Strategic Use of Headings (H1-H6) for Structure and Keyword Integration

The strategic use of headings, ranging from H1 to H6, plays a vital role in structuring the content of a landing page and signaling its key topics to both users and search engines. The H1 tag should be used for the main headline of the page and should incorporate the primary keyword, providing a clear summary of the page's content.5 It is best practice to use only one H1 tag per page to establish a clear topic hierarchy.

H2 to H6 subheadings should then be utilized to break up the content into smaller, more digestible sections, improving readability and allowing for the natural integration of secondary and related keywords.5 Maintaining a logical hierarchical order of headings is crucial, as it helps both users and search engine crawlers understand the structure and importance of the information presented on the page.20 This clear organization not only enhances the user experience by making the content easier to scan and navigate but also provides valuable context to search engines, helping them better understand and rank the landing page for relevant search queries.

4.3 Crafting High-Quality, Engaging, and Relevant Content

The creation of high-quality, engaging, and relevant content is fundamental to the success of any landing page SEO strategy.3 The content should be clear, concise, and directly address the user's search intent, providing valuable information or a compelling offer that meets their needs.3 Instead of simply listing product or service features, the content should focus on the benefits for the user, highlighting how the offering can solve their problems or improve their situation.5

To build trust and credibility, it is highly effective to incorporate customer stories, testimonials, and social proof on the landing page.5 The content itself should be unique, original, and up-to-date, providing fresh insights and value rather than simply rehashing existing information.5 To enhance user experience, the content should be presented in a readable and scannable format, utilizing short paragraphs, bullet points, and lists to break up text and make it easier to digest.7 By focusing on creating high-quality content that is engaging and directly relevant to the target audience, businesses can not only improve their search engine rankings but also significantly increase their landing page conversion rates.

4.4 Optimizing Images with Descriptive Alt Text

Optimizing images on a landing page is crucial for both user experience and SEO. A key aspect of image optimization is the use of descriptive alt text for all images.5 Alt text, which is an alternative text description of an image, serves several important purposes. It improves accessibility for visually impaired users who rely on screen readers, and it helps search engines understand the content and context of the image. When writing alt text, it is recommended to be descriptive and specific, using relevant keywords where appropriate, but avoiding keyword stuffing.10 The alt text should be concise, ideally under 125 characters, and accurately reflect the image's content and its relevance to the surrounding page text.60 Additionally, using descriptive filenames for images, separated by dashes, can provide further context to search engines.60 By optimizing images with thoughtful alt text, businesses can enhance the SEO of their landing pages, potentially improving their visibility in both web and image search results.

5. Technical SEO Aspects Relevant to Landing Pages

5.1 Optimizing Page Load Speed for Better User Experience and Rankings

In the realm of landing page SEO, optimizing page load speed is a critical technical aspect that directly impacts both user experience and search engine rankings. Users have little patience for slow-loading pages, and even a delay of a few seconds can lead to a significant increase in bounce rates.3 Google also considers page speed as a ranking factor, making it a crucial element for SEO. Aiming for a load time of under 2.5 seconds is generally recommended.

Several techniques can be employed to optimize page speed. Image optimization is key, involving compressing images without sacrificing too much quality and using appropriate file formats like WebP, which offers better compression.3 Minifying CSS, JavaScript, and HTML files by removing unnecessary characters and code can also reduce file sizes and improve loading times.3 Leveraging browser caching allows browsers to store static assets locally, reducing loading times for returning visitors.3 Utilizing a Content Delivery Network (CDN) can also significantly improve load times, especially for users geographically distant from the server.3 Minimizing the number of HTTP requests and reducing the use of unnecessary redirects can also contribute to faster loading times.3 By implementing these strategies, businesses can significantly improve the loading speed of their landing pages, leading to a better user experience and potentially higher search engine rankings.

5.2 Ensuring Mobile-Friendliness and Responsiveness for Diverse Devices

Given that a significant portion of online traffic originates from mobile devices, ensuring mobile-friendliness and responsiveness is paramount for landing page SEO.3 Google's mobile-first indexing prioritizes the mobile version of a website for indexing and ranking purposes 3, making it essential for landing pages to provide a seamless and user-friendly experience on smartphones and tablets. Implementing a responsive design ensures that the landing page automatically adjusts its layout, images, and text to fit different screen sizes, providing an optimal viewing experience across all devices.3 This includes ensuring that buttons and links are appropriately sized for touchscreens and that content fits within the screen width without requiring horizontal scrolling.5 By prioritizing the mobile experience, businesses can ensure their landing pages perform well in Google's mobile-first index and provide a positive experience for the majority of their users.

5.3 Implementing Schema Markup to Enhance Search Engine Understanding

Schema markup, which is a form of structured data that can be added to a landing page's HTML, plays a vital role in helping search engines understand the content and context of the page.3 By implementing specific schema types relevant to the landing page's content, such as Product schema for product pages, Review schema for pages featuring customer reviews, LocalBusiness schema for local businesses, or FAQ schema for pages with frequently asked questions, businesses can enhance the way their landing pages appear in search results.19 This can lead to rich snippets, which are enhanced search results that may include additional information like star ratings, prices, and event details, potentially improving the click-through rate (CTR) and driving more qualified traffic to the landing page.19 By making it easier for search engines to understand the purpose and content of their landing pages, businesses can improve their overall SEO performance and attract users who are more likely to convert.

5.4 Ensuring Proper Indexing and Crawlability by Google

To ensure that landing pages are visible in Google Search, it is crucial to focus on proper indexing and crawlability. The robots.txt file, located in the root directory of a website, can be used to guide search engine crawlers and manage crawl budget by specifying which parts of the site they should or should not access.3 However, it is important to note that robots.txt should not be used for hiding pages from search results; for this purpose, noindex meta tags or HTTP headers are more effective, instructing search engines not to include specific pages (such as thank you pages or internal-only content) in their index.181

Submitting an XML sitemap to Google Search Console is a crucial step in helping Google discover and index all the important landing pages on a website.3 This file provides a list of all the important URLs on the site, along with metadata about when they were last updated, how often they change, and their relative importance. Finally, ensuring a proper internal linking structure helps Google crawl and understand the relationships between different pages on the website, which can improve the discoverability and ranking of landing pages.3

6. The Crucial Relationship Between User Experience (UX) and SEO for Landing Pages

6.1 Impact of Page Design and Visual Hierarchy on User Engagement

The design and visual hierarchy of a landing page play a pivotal role in influencing user engagement, which in turn has a significant impact on its SEO performance. A clean, simple, and minimalistic design helps to focus the user's attention on the core message and the call-to-action, reducing distractions and making it easier for visitors to understand the offer.3 A clear visual hierarchy is essential for guiding visitors through the content, directing their attention to the most important elements and ultimately towards the call-to-action.3 The strategic use of whitespace enhances readability and helps to emphasize important elements on the page.3 Finally, the incorporation of high-quality and relevant visuals can significantly enhance engagement and help to convey the message more effectively.3 These design elements collectively contribute to a positive user experience, which is increasingly recognized by Google as an important factor in search rankings.

6.2 Clarity and Effectiveness of Call-to-Actions (CTAs) in Driving Conversions

The clarity and effectiveness of calls-to-action (CTAs) are paramount for driving conversions on landing pages.3 These are the prompts that encourage visitors to take the desired action, and their effectiveness can significantly impact conversion rates. CTAs should utilize clear, concise, and action-oriented language, such as "Download Now," "Sign Up Today," or "Get Your Free Quote".3 They should be visually distinct from the rest of the page, utilizing contrasting colors and a prominent placement to attract attention.3 The CTA should be carefully aligned with the landing page's overall goal and the user's intent.3 To optimize their effectiveness, different variations of CTAs should be tested (in terms of wording, color, and placement) to identify what resonates best with the target audience.3

6.3 The Role of Overall User Satisfaction in Google Rankings

Google increasingly considers overall user satisfaction as a crucial factor in determining search rankings for landing pages.3 This is often gauged through user engagement metrics such as dwell time (the amount of time a user spends on a page before returning to the search results), bounce rate (the percentage of visitors who leave a site after viewing only one page), and click-through rate (CTR) from the search results.3 Positive user signals, such as long clicks (when a user stays on a page for a significant amount of time before returning to the SERP), low bounce rates, and high dwell times, can indicate that users are finding the content valuable and relevant to their search queries.3 Conversely, negative signals can indicate that the landing page is not meeting user expectations and may lead to lower rankings. Therefore, optimizing landing pages for a positive user experience is not only crucial for driving conversions but also for improving their visibility in Google Search.

7. Investigating the Importance of Mobile Optimization for Landing Pages in the Context of Google's Mobile-First Indexing

7.1 The Significance of Mobile Optimization for Google's Mobile-First Indexing

In today's digital landscape, where mobile devices account for a substantial majority of internet traffic, mobile optimization has become an indispensable aspect of SEO, particularly for landing pages. Google's implementation of mobile-first indexing signifies a fundamental shift in how the search engine crawls, indexes, and ranks web content.3 This approach means that Google primarily uses the mobile version of a website's content to determine its ranking in search results, even for searches conducted on desktop devices. Consequently, if a landing page is not optimized for mobile devices, it risks receiving lower rankings, reduced visibility, and ultimately a decrease in organic traffic and conversions.

The shift to mobile-first indexing underscores the critical need for businesses to prioritize providing a seamless and user-friendly experience on mobile devices. Websites that are not mobile-optimized may struggle to compete in search results, regardless of how well their desktop version performs.105 Ensuring that landing pages are mobile-friendly is therefore not just a matter of enhancing user experience but a fundamental requirement for maintaining and improving search engine rankings in the mobile-first era.

7.2 Best Practices for Creating Responsive and User-Friendly Mobile Experiences

Creating responsive and user-friendly mobile experiences for landing pages involves several key best practices. Implementing a responsive design is paramount, ensuring that the landing page adapts seamlessly to different screen sizes and orientations, providing an optimal viewing and interaction experience across all devices.3 This eliminates the need for separate mobile and desktop versions and ensures content consistency.

Optimizing page speed is also critical for mobile users, who often have less patience for slow-loading pages.3 Simplifying design and navigation, using concise copy, and ensuring that buttons and other interactive elements are adequately sized for touchscreens are also crucial for a positive mobile user experience.5 Avoiding the use of intrusive pop-ups on mobile devices is also a recommended practice.5 By adhering to these guidelines, businesses can create mobile landing pages that not only perform well in search rankings but also provide a positive and effective user experience.
